A total of 19 vehicles belonging to Kampala Modernity Limited, a car import firm, have been impounded by the Kampala City Council (KCC).
The KCC spokesperson, Simon Muhumuza, said they impounded the cars on Thursday because they had been parked in a road reserve. He said they took action after the firm, located in Bugolobi, defied a seven-day notice to remove their vehicles.
He added that they had ordered the firm to remove its cars and restore the lawn destroyed but they refused.
